Meet Kimberly Evans Paige
EVP, Chief Marketing Officer at BET (BET Networks, a subsidiary of Viacom Inc.)
When it comes to understanding how to build and market a brand, there are few with Kim's experience and talent. With a BA from Howard University and MBA from Clark Atlanta University, Kim began her journey at one the best places to learn marketing Procter & Gamble. After a few years she started her own marketing consultancy before joining The Coca-Cola Company for an epic almost 2-decade run. She began as Global Director on Sprite rising to VP Marketing & Innovation, Ventures and Emerging Brands. In 2017 she became CMO for Coty and later joined Sundial Brands as Chief Operating & Brand Officer.
Paige joined BET in September of 2019, bringing decades of experience in marketing and branding with companies like Coca-Cola and Sundial Brands.
